Captain Marvel's pretty good, don't understand why people are calling it cookie cutter Marvel considering how much of the formula it breaks. Like the last battle isn't between Captain Marvel and Evil Bigger Captain Marvel, an annoying trope even Black Panther suffered from. There isn't a generic origin story in the first act, the character progression isn't trying to do Iron Man again. Sure, there's still quips and the fights aren't the best choreographed, but it's got more personality than like, Ant-man. Oh and there's really not nearly enough air force stuff to call the movie propaganda. The USAF is mostly portrayed as a bunch of dicks except for 2 of the main character's friends and there's barely any time spent on her as a pilot. They shoved all that stuff in the marketing.
